The Doula Studies Undergraduate Certificate at Fanshawe College equips you with the specialized knowledge, skills, and ethical framework to provide client-centred support across the full spectrum of reproductive experiences. You will delve into the historical context of reproductive culture, anatomy and physiology of reproduction, and the emotional and physical aspects of pregnancy, birth, and postpartum care. This program is designed for individuals passionate about supporting families through evidence-informed practice, preparing you to advocate, educate, and collaborate within diverse healthcare settings and communities.
This full-time, on-campus program is delivered over two 15-week terms, offering a hands-on learning experience. You will engage with mandatory courses covering advanced birth and postpartum topics, alongside essential business management and entrepreneurship concepts crucial for establishing your practice. Through two practicum courses, you will gain invaluable real-world experience, directly applying your learning. Graduates will be prepared for rewarding careers as unregulated health care professionals, collaborating with health care teams and supporting individuals and families through informed, compassionate doula care.
